Bedtime Baby & Toddler Routine

This post may contain affiliate and/or sponsored links. For more information be sure to check out my disclosure policy. 

Bedtime has been a struggle, the only thing that keeps my sanity is the routine. Now that we have a little baby and a tiny tot to get ready for bed, things can get hectic. When my little ones know what comes next and know what to expect, it helps.

My tiny tot was once lucky enough to get a sweet lullaby, a book read to her and a kiss goodnight. These days we are juggling bedtime with her and her sister. Their bedtimes are also drastically different. My toddler can get herself dressed and set up her room as she desires. She has certain stuffed animals, night lights, a noisemaker and a fan she likes to have on. My little babe obviously requires my undivided attention and a bit more work.

One thing that both my kids have always loved, is bath time. We learned quickly that zip up pajamas and onesies were the best bet. She also sleeps in a sleep sack, we refer to this as a “zippy” in our house. My daughter will not sleep without it, trust me…I’ve tried. She immediately goes down after bath time, so we try to keep things mellow. She has a small lamp on her changing table that we use for lighting. She also uses a noisemaker and a humidifier that we run nightly.
